Gülağaç (formerly Ağaçlı ) is a city and a district in the Turkish province of Aksaray . About 23 percent of the district population is in the district town. The small district is located in the east of the province and borders the Nevşehir province .
The district was founded in 1990 and, in addition to the district town (23% of the district population), has three other municipalities ( Belde ): Demirci (4,280), Gülpınar (2,838) and Saratlı (2,237 inhabitants). Nine villages ( Köy ) complete the district, with Bekarlar (1,084) and Kızılkaya (1,366) having over 1,000 inhabitants. Each village has an average of 657 people.
